spring security remember me example
This tutorial shows you Remember-Me authentication using Spring Security 4 with Hibernate. protected AuthenticationDetailsSource: getAuthenticationDetailsSource() protected String: getCookieName() String: getKey() String: getParameter() protected int: getTokenValiditySeconds() protected UserDetailsService Introduction. This cookie will be stored at browser side … Locates the Spring Security remember me cookie in the request and returns its value. This tutorial will show how to enable and configure Remember Me functionality in a web application with Spring Security. The following code examples are extracted from open source projects. Spring Security - Form Login, Remember Me and Logout - Spring Security comes with a ton of built-in features and tools for our convenience. Here we are configuring the Remember Me authentication using Java Configuration. 1. Background information 2. Note: This example is based on the Simple Hash-Based Token Approach which uses the hashing technique to create the unique token. Environment Setup 1. Spring Boot 3. 1. Remember-me authentication is a solution for websites to remember the identity of a user between sessions. Spring Security Remember Me Hashing Authentication Configuration. REST APIs are used in every language and on every platform. One uses hashing to preserve the security of cookie-based tokens and the other uses a database or other persistent … Related Articles: – How to configure Remember Me authentication by Hash-Based Token Approach – Spring Security – Config Security for Web MVC by Spring … Wednesday, 8 January 2014 Spring Security: Remember me Example Remember me authentication is a mechanism that allows a user to maintain his identity across multiple browser sessions. . Spring Security; SEC-1910; Remember me docs should mention login form requires '_spring_security_remember_me' field In this technique, a token is created using the key, expiry date, password, and username. In this post, we will build a full-blown Spring MVC application secured using Spring Security, integrating with MySQL database using Hibernate, handling Many-to-Many relationship on view, storing passwords in encrypted format using BCrypt, and providing RememberMe functionality using custom PersistentTokenRepository implementation with Hibernate HibernateTokenRepositoryImpl, retrieving … Then you can display email, username, first name, last name, full name, assigned roles, any user’s information in the view (using Thymeleaf); and also get the UserDetails object in a handler method of a Spring controller. I'm developing a Spring MVC web app and have configured the Spring Security to intercept all URLs and authenticate them. In this article, Toptal Freelance Java Developer Sergio Moretti shows how to secure a REST API using Spring Boot. Spring Security provides the necessary hooks for these operations to take place, and has two concrete remember-me implementations. I have been trying to implement spring security 3.0 remember me service in my application but unfortunately couldn't get it working. Following is the screenshot: Run Application. Ensures that the session cookie expires at Integer.MAX_VALUE. Client side codes are also similar to whatever we have defined in the previous post Spring Security with Spring MVC Example Using Spring Boot.All these are available in the source code which you can download a the end of the post below. First, we’re going to enable the basic remember-me functionality in the security config: .rememberMe().key("lssAppKey") We are then going to add the remember-me … Table of Contents 1. Spring Security Remember Me example; Tags : spring security. In this article, we will look at the Spring security filters chain. If the user ticks the "remember me", to automatically log in the user without redirecting to the login page.Say, my login URL is In this example we will see spring security using Persistent Token Approach with a simple login form. Most Voted. Test the … Let’s get going. Configure DelegatingFilterProxy in web.xml 4. Nirman's Tech Blog Let the code do the talking !!! Add security configuration in application-security.xml 5. Contribute to cavalr/SpringSecurityRememberMe development by creating an account on GitHub. Maven Maven Dependencies. In this example, we … One uses hashing to preserve the security of cookie-based tokens and the other uses a database or other persistent storage mechanism to store the generated tokens. Building a secure REST API is a must-have tool in every developer's arsenal. This article is a continuation of our series on using OAuth 2 to secure a Spring REST API, which is accessed through an AngularJS Client. In addition, another table is PERSISTENT_LOGINS, which is used by Spring Remember Me API to store ... SNAPSHOT
jar SpringBootSecurityJPA Spring Boot +Spring Security + JPA + Remember Me
Ford Stock Dividend History,
South Central Correctional Facility Visitation Form,
Harrisburg, Sd School District Jobs,
Mallory Unilite Distributor Rotor,
Offline Battle Royale Games Ios,
Yorkie Puppy Weight Calculator,
Location Bridge Of Eldin Botw Map,
Chili Pepper's Tanning Near Me,
Struggle Meals Hotdishes,
When Does Odysseus Return Home,
Arm Gatekeeper Shotgun Slug,